1) The document discusses lexical cohesion, which refers to the cohesive effect achieved through the selection and repetition of vocabulary within a text. 2) Lexical cohesion can be created through the use of general nouns, reiteration of the same lexeme, lexical relations like synonyms, and collocations between words that share the same semantic field. 3) While individual lexical items on their own do not indicate cohesive function, words can serve a cohesive role when they are part of a whole text through relationships like repetition, hypernymy and collocation.
